Candy Claw Machine, from Thames & Kosmos, puts an educational spin on the classic arcade game. This do-it-yourself kit lets kids build and engineer their own claw machine, using gears, cranks, belts, and levers. Then they can add their favorite treats—a supply of lollipops and decoy candy boxes is included—and practice reaching for prizes. The set also comes with three interchangeable claw types that kids can use to scoop and score.

It is also great for the imaginations of kids while teaching them how to code; the noises and visuals are entertaining. A real robot also offers some neat science lessons along the way. For example, Dash doesn’t actually turn his wheels, he just spins one faster than the other. Your child can set the speeds for each wheel individually, getting them to understand the physics behind this through play and experimentation.
